Ube Brochi® (Purple Yam Brownie Mochi)

Ube Brochi® is a baked treat combining purple yam with mochi flour to create a dessert that blends the chewy texture of mochi with the sweet, earthy flavor of ube. Its brownie-like appearance and texture come from the mix of grated ube, egg, coconut milk, sugar, and mochiko flour, baked until firm yet tender.

Description

This recipe for Ube Brochi® uses frozen grated ube mixed with egg, sugar, coconut milk,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t, then combined with mochiko flour (glutinous rice flour). Baking the batter produces a dense, slightly chewy, and moist texture reminiscent of both brownies and mochi desserts. Covering the pan with foil partway through baking prevents over-browning while allowing it to cook evenly.

The final product has a rich purple color and a subtly sweet, earthy taste from the ube. It can be sliced into multiple servings, making it convenient for sharing or for multiple treats across several occasions.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 180 g ube frozen, grated
  • 1 egg large
  • 50 g granulated cane sugar
  • 125 ml coconut milk sub with whole milk or any non-dairy alternative
  • 5 ml vanilla extract
  • tiny pinch of sea salt
  • 130 g Mochiko flour or glutinous rice flour

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F/177°C.
  2. Line an 8" by 8" baking pan with parchment paper.
  3. In a large bowl, whisk together the grated ube, egg, sugar, milk, vanilla extract, and sea salt until smooth.
  4. Add in the mochiko (or glutinous rice flour) and whisk until incorporated.
  5.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an.
  6. Give it a few taps to release any trapped bubbles.
  7. Bake at 350°F/177°C for about 40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. (To prevent excessive browning, cover with aluminum foil about 10 minutes into the bake).
  8. Let cool in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to completely cool.
  9. Slice into 16 pieces and serve.
